How Many Solar Panels for a $175 Electric Bill in Tennessee?
Tennessee electricity rates and sun hours change the math versus the US average. The sizing formula:
System size (kW) = Annual kWh ÷ (Peak sun hours × 365 × 0.82)
For a $175/month bill in Tennessee:
Annual usage: ~17,213 kWh/year
Peak sun hours: 5.0 h/day (Tennessee)
System size:11.5 kW DC (~29 × 400W panels)

What Does Solar Cost for a $175/Month Bill in Tennessee After the ITC?
At $3.00/W installed (SEIA 2026 US average), a 11.5 kW system in Tennessee costs about $34,500 before incentives.
The 30% Residential Clean Energy Credit (ITC) under IRC Section 25D saves roughly $10,350, bringing net cost to $24,200. The credit applies to purchased systems placed in service through 2032; consult a CPA for your tax situation.

How Long Is Solar Payback on a $175 Bill in Tennessee?
Simple payback divides net system cost by first-year bill savings. In Tennessee, a 11.5 kW system saving ~$1,827/year against a $175/month bill pays back in about 13.2 years after the ITC.
At 3% annual rate escalation (EIA historical average), 25-year utility spend totals ~$76,600 vs $24,200 net solar cost — an estimated $52,400+ lifetime advantage. Model your timeline in our solar payback calculator.

Tennessee Solar Incentives for a $175/Month Electric Bill
Tennessee does not offer a state solar tax credit. TVA (Tennessee Valley Authority) customers may be eligible for the TVA Green Power Providers program. EPB in Chattanooga and other municipally-owned utilities have their own renewable energy programs. Federal 30% ITC applies to all Tennessee installations.
